Исходный код вики Управление шпинделем

Версия 4.7 от abolgov на 2022/06/17 13:56

Скрыть последних авторов
knetyaga 1.1 1 === number SpindleGetCurRPM () ===
2
3 Получение текущей скорости вращения шпинделя.
4
5 Возвращаемое значение:
6
7 * текущая скорость вращения шпинделя, об/мин.
8
abolgov 3.1 9 === number GetGCodeSpindleRPM () ===
10
11 Получение скорости вращения шпинделя, заданной в G-коде.
12
13 Возвращаемое значение:
14
15 * Скорость вращения шпинделя, заданная в G-коде, об/мин.
16
knetyaga 1.1 17 === number SpindleGetOverridePercent () ===
18
19 Получение процента переопределения текущей скорости вращения шпинделя.
20
21 Возвращаемое значение:
22
23 * процент, который фактическая скорость вращения шпинделя составляет от заданной.
24
25 === void SpindleStartCW () ===
26
27 Включение вращения шпинделя по часовой стрелке.
28
29 === void SpindleStartCCW () ===
30
31 Включение вращения шпинделя против часовой стрелки.
32
33 === void SpindleStartCWRPM (number rpm) ===
34
35 Включение вращения шпинделя по часовой стрелке с указанной скоростью вращения.
36
37 Параметры:
38
39 * number rpm – желаемая скорость вращения шпинделя.
40
41 === void SpindleStartCCWRPM (number rpm) ===
42
43 Включение вращения шпинделя против часовой стрелки с указанной скоростью вращения.
44
45 Параметры:
46
47 * number rpm – желаемая скорость вращения шпинделя.
48
49 === void SpindleStop () ===
50
51 Остановка вращения шпинделя.
abolgov 3.1 52
53 === bool GetSpindleAutoStop () ===
54
55 Позволяет проверить, активна ли опция автоматического отключения шпинделя при остановке выполнения G-кода.
56
57 Возвращаемое значение:
58
59 * true – если автоматическое отключение шпинделя при остановке выполнения G-кода активно.